Job Title: Project Manager – Cybersecurity & Technology Infrastructure

Location: Charlotte, NC or London, UK
Employment Type: Full-Time
Area: Technology & Infrastructure Delivery

About Barings

Barings is a leading global financial services firm dedicated to meeting the evolving investment and capital needs of our clients and customers. Through active asset management and direct origination, we provide innovative solutions and access to differentiated opportunities across public and private capital markets. A subsidiary of MassMutual, Barings maintains a strong global presence with business and investment professionals located across North America, Europe and Asia Pacific.

About the Role

The Enterprise Delivery team at Barings is seeking an experienced Project Manager to lead strategic initiatives across our Cybersecurity and Technology Infrastructure portfolio. This role is ideal for a candidate who thrives in a fast-paced, regulated environment and is passionate about delivering impactful technology solutions that enhance enterprise resilience and operational efficiency. 

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ead cross-functional project teams to deliver infrastructure initiatives including:
    • Hosting platform transitions
    • Network modernization
    • Business and Technology Resiliency
    • End-user computing (EUC) upgrades and implementations
    • Cybersecurity controls and compliance initiatives
  • Define project scope, goals, and deliverables in collaboration with stakeholders.
  • Develop and manage detailed project plans, budgets, and resource allocations.
  • Drive stakeholder engagement, challenge with positive intent and communicate across business and technical teams.
  • Identify and mitigate risks, manage dependencies, and resolve issues proactively.
  • Ensure alignment with enterprise architecture, security standards, and regulatory requirements.
  • Prepare executive-level reporting, dashboards, and steering committee updates.
  • Support change management, training, and adoption strategies.
  • Demonstrates versatility by effectively wearing multiple hats, adapting to various roles and responsibilities to meet the dynamic needs of the organization.
  • Demonstrates ability to manage global teams and navigate cross-cultural collaboration.

Qualifications

  • 7+ years of project management experience in Financial Services, IT infrastructure or cybersecurity.
  • Proven track record delivering complex projects in multi-national enterprises.
  • Basic understanding of:
    • Networking (LAN/WAN, VWan, firewalls)
    • Hosting (VMware, Nutanix, cloud platforms)
    • IT Service Management (CMDB, Technology Delivery Change Frameworks)
    • EUC (Windows 365, Copilot, DaaS, device lifecycle)
    • Cybersecurity frameworks (NIST, ISO 27001)
    • Data Operations and Enterprise data reporting
  • Familiarity with Agile, Waterfall, and hybrid delivery models.
  • Excellent communication, leadership, and stakeholder management skills.
  • PMP or equivalent certification preferred.

Preferred Experience

  • Experience in financial services or other regulated industries.
  • Working knowledge of Smartsheet, MS Project, ServiceNow, Azure DevOps, Microsoft 365 suite.
  • Ability to manage global teams and navigate cross-cultural collaboration.

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ene

Ranked among the hottest tech cities in 2024 by CompTIA, Charlotte is quickly cementing its place as a major U.S. tech hub. Home to more than 90,000 tech workers, the city’s ecosystem is primed for continued growth, fueled by billions in annual funding from heavyweights like Microsoft and RevTech Labs, which has created thousands of fintech jobs and made the city a go-to for tech pros looking for their next big opportunity.

Key Facts About Charlotte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
  •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
  •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
